We are seeking a skilled HVAC Service Technician to join our team. You will be responsible for troubleshooting, maintaining, and repairing various HVAC units including chillers, condensers, package units, roof top units, and split systems. Your expertise in HVAC refrigeration and preventative maintenance will be crucial to ensuring our systems operate smoothly.
Responsibilities- Troubleshoot and repair HVAC units including chillers, condensers, package units, roof top units, and split systems.
- Perform preventative maintenance on HVAC systems to ensure optimal performance.
- Conduct HVAC refrigeration repairs and maintenance.
- Handle HVAC installation and piping tasks with precision.
- Perform boiler and chiller repairs as needed.
- Utilize blueprints to guide installation and repair processes.
- Expertise in HVAC installation, fitting, and system maintenance.
- Proficiency in piping, threading, brazing, and air conditioning troubleshooting.
- Ability to work with central plant HVAC systems.
- 5+ years of experience in HVAC repair and maintenance.
- Clean Motor Vehicle Record (MVR).
- OSHA 30 certification.
- SST 10 certification is preferred but not required.
